To prevent trips at night, use reflective markers like strips, tapes, or badges on your clothing and gear. These markers bounce light back to drivers and others, making you visible in low light conditions. Make certain they are positioned on key areas like shoes, backpacks, or jackets. Combining reflective markers with active lighting, such as flashlights, boosts safety even more. Nighttime visibility is essential for your safety on the road, as it directly impacts how well you can see and be seen by others. When darkness falls, your ability to stand out to drivers or pedestrians makes all the difference. That’s why wearing proper safety gear is crucial. High-quality reflective clothing is a simple yet effective way to increase your visibility. These garments are designed with reflective strips that bounce light back to its source, making you much more noticeable in low-light conditions. Whether you’re jogging, cycling, or walking, reflective clothing acts as a personal beacon, alerting others to your presence from a distance.

Nighttime safety depends on high-quality reflective clothing that makes you visible in low-light conditions.

Investing in good safety gear isn’t just about comfort; it’s about prevention. Reflective accessories, like vests, armbands, or even shoes, enhance your visibility from multiple angles. You want to be seen from the front, back, and sides, especially in poorly lit areas or when crossing streets. Wearing bright, reflective clothing ensures you won’t blend into the background, reducing the risk of trips, falls, or accidents. You should also consider adding reflective tape to backpacks, hats, or jackets for extra visibility. The more reflective surfaces you have, the safer you’ll be when processing dark streets or trails.

It’s important to remember that safety gear isn’t just for outdoor activities. Even when walking through parking lots or urban areas at night, reflective clothing can alert drivers to your presence. Many accidents happen because pedestrians or cyclists aren’t easily seen, especially when they’re dressed in dark clothing. Bright, reflective outfits serve as a visual cue that you’re in the area, prompting drivers to slow down or be more cautious. Always check that your safety gear is in good condition—reflective strips should be clean, intact, and visible from a distance. Additionally, using a flashlight or headlamp alongside reflective clothing can boost your visibility further. These tools help illuminate your path and draw attention to you simultaneously. Remember, the goal is to make sure you’re easily seen from afar, and combining safety gear with active lighting options provides the best results. How Do Different Lighting Conditions Affect Marker Visibility?

Lighting conditions are like a chameleon, changing how well markers stand out. In low light, glow-in-the-dark markers absorb light and shine brightly, making steps clear. Reflective coatings bounce back light from flashlights or car headlights, increasing visibility instantly. Bright sunlight can overshadow glow-in-the-dark features, but reflective coatings still work well in foggy or rainy conditions. Understanding these differences helps you choose the right markers for safety at any time.

Are There Specific Colors That Improve Nighttime Visibility?

Yes, certain colors enhance nighttime visibility. Bright, high-contrast colors like yellow, orange, and white stand out well against dark backgrounds. Using reflective coatings on these markers further improves their visibility by reflecting light from headlights or flashlights. Combining color contrast with reflective materials makes markers easier to see in low-light conditions, helping prevent trips and accidents during nighttime activities.
